3. Balance tie rod on the top of the front wheel shock tower of a Petrol Car
Designed to be mounted on top of the front shock tower. The main function is to enhance the rigidity of the cabin and front body, offset the frame deformation caused by centrifugal lateral torque (in severe cases, the deformation can cause the tower roof to tear), improve the turning ability of Honda Car, increase the turning speed, and reduce the deformation of the body caused by centrifugal force. roll angle;
4. Front bottom beam balance tie rod
Designed to be installed at the connection between the front axle and the frame chassis. The main function is to enhance the connection strength between the front sill (front axle) and the chassis, and reduce the displacement and deformation of the front axle due to centrifugal force and body distortion. Its main function is also to improve cornering performance;
5. Balance tie rod on the top of the rear wheel shock tower of a Petrol Car
Designed to be mounted on top of the rear shock tower. The main function is to enhance the strength of the trunk, reduce the lateral distortion caused by centrifugal force at the rear of the car, reduce the roll of the rear of the car when turning, and improve the turning performance of Honda Car;
6. Rear axle suspension of Honda Car with enhanced balance tie rods
The connection position between the rear axle of the Petrol Car and the rear of the frame chassis is designed and installed. Its main function is to strengthen the connection strength between the rear axle and the frame;
7. Petrol Car frame (body) chassis reinforced balance tie rod
Designed to be installed in the middle part of the frame chassis, its main function is to enhance the overall rigidity of the frame chassis. According to the factory design of Honda Car, the frame structures are different, some are omitted, and some are replaced by other structures.
In addition, there are professionally modified body (cockpit) anti-roll braces and side door reinforced steel beams to enhance the overall rigidity of the body. These are highly specialized and necessary modification projects for competition. The material of the balance bar is very particular and cannot be easily replaced by ordinary steel. It not only requires the mass to be as light as possible, but also requires it to match the hardness of the body material, so as to combine rigidity and softness to form a harmonious whole.
Models with different chassis designs generally cannot be freely used as accessories for other models. After a serious collision, all relevant deformed stabilizer bars and their components should be replaced rather than completely repaired through heat correction. Otherwise, even if it is modified and reset, the changes in the material itself will affect the safety and stability of high-speed driving.
